Yet again, I have tried a new OS on my Laptop on the Side: PikaOS, the Niri edition which basically needs zero configuration outside of changing a few things. As the creator was kind enough to include a settings menu that basically allows the user to make useful changes without ever touching a config file. I like that for the time being. PikaOS is based on Debian which means I can use .deb packages and install packages conventionally.
I really like how it flows right out of the box. It's fairly polished, however, the login greeter will duplicate some of my keyboard inputs. It's not the worst issue out of the gate and it could be fixed. I tipped them a coffee as a way of thanks for a decent experience. I'll probably install another distro on this thing now.
